Understanding 0x Protocol: A Comprehensive Guide to Decentralized Trading
The rise of decentralized finance (DeFi) has transformed the way we think about financial transactions and asset management. 0x Protocol stands as one of the most important innovations in this space, offering a decentralized solution for peer-to-peer trading of assets on the Ethereum blockchain. By facilitating trustless, peer-to-peer exchanges, 0x Protocol has paved the way for more secure and transparent financial transactions, helping users avoid the risks associated with centralized exchanges.
In this article, we’ll explore what 0x Protocol is, how it works, and why it is becoming a vital component of the DeFi ecosystem.
What is 0x Protocol?
0x Protocol is an open-source project that aims to improve the functionality and efficiency of decentralized exchanges (DEX). Built on the Ethereum blockchain, the protocol provides a framework for peer-to-peer (P2P) trading without the need for intermediaries. Essentially, 0x Protocol allows users to trade digital assets directly with one another, which eliminates the need for centralized exchanges and the associated risks of hacking and mismanagement.
The protocol offers a standardized infrastructure for creating decentralized applications (dApps) and trading platforms. By using smart contracts, 0x ensures that trades are executed only when certain conditions are met, providing security and reducing the risk of fraud.
How Does 0x Protocol Work?
0x Protocol is based on the concept of off-chain order books and on-chain settlement. This architecture ensures that users can make trades without compromising on security or liquidity. Here's how it works:
1. Off-chain Order Books: Traditional exchanges store orders on centralized servers. However, with 0x Protocol, the order book is stored off-chain, meaning it is managed by relayers (third-party services) who match buy and sell orders. This allows for faster and more scalable trading while reducing gas fees, which are typically high on-chain.
2. On-chain Settlement: Once a trade is matched off-chain, the actual settlement happens on the Ethereum blockchain using smart contracts. This ensures that all trades are secure, verifiable, and irreversible.
3. Relayers: These are entities that host order books and facilitate the matching of buy and sell orders. Relayers are not required to hold funds, making them more secure than centralized exchanges. They also charge a small fee for the services they provide.
4. ZRX Token: The native token of the 0x Protocol, ZRX, is used for governance and transaction fees. ZRX holders can vote on protocol upgrades and other decisions, ensuring a decentralized control structure. Additionally, ZRX is used to pay relayers for facilitating trades.
Key Benefits of 0x Protocol
1. Decentralization: One of the main appeals of 0x Protocol is its decentralized nature. By eliminating intermediaries and relying on smart contracts, 0x provides users with more control over their assets and ensures that trades are conducted in a trustless environment.
2. Security: Unlike centralized exchanges that can be hacked, 0x Protocol reduces the risk of asset theft since funds are never held by relayers. Transactions are executed on-chain, and users retain full control of their private keys.
3. Liquidity: The 0x Protocol allows various platforms to contribute liquidity to the ecosystem. This is important because liquidity is a key factor for any exchange to operate efficiently. Through 0x, users can access liquidity from multiple sources, ensuring better trade execution and lower slippage.
4. Low Fees: Since the protocol uses off-chain order books, users can avoid high transaction costs typically associated with on-chain order matching. The decentralized nature also leads to lower overall fees compared to traditional exchanges.
Applications of 0x Protocol
0x Protocol has a wide range of applications, particularly within the DeFi ecosystem:
1. Decentralized Exchanges (DEX): Several DEX platforms use 0x Protocol to match orders between buyers and sellers. By leveraging 0x, these platforms can provide a more secure and efficient trading environment.
2. NFT Marketplaces: The 0x Protocol also enables decentralized trading of non-fungible tokens (NFTs). This is becoming increasingly popular in the NFT space, where buyers and sellers can trade digital assets without the need for an intermediary.
3. Lending and Borrowing Platforms: Some decentralized lending platforms use 0x for facilitating peer-to-peer lending and borrowing, providing users with greater flexibility and security in these transactions.
Why 0x Protocol Is Crucial for DeFi
0x Protocol plays a critical role in the growth and development of decentralized finance (DeFi). As DeFi continues to disrupt traditional financial systems, solutions like 0x are essential for enabling secure, low-cost, and efficient decentralized trading. By offering a scalable framework for DeFi applications, 0x helps unlock liquidity and ensures that trades can be executed quickly and securely.
Moreover, the protocol’s emphasis on decentralization and security makes it a vital tool for ensuring that DeFi remains open and accessible to everyone, without the risks and inefficiencies associated with centralized systems.
Conclusion
0x Protocol has emerged as one of the most significant innovations in the DeFi space, providing a robust and secure framework for decentralized trading. Its unique combination of off-chain order books and on-chain settlement, along with its emphasis on decentralization and security, makes it an essential tool for users and developers within the DeFi ecosystem.
Whether you are a trader, developer, or enthusiast, understanding how 0x Protocol works and its key benefits can help you navigate the ever-expanding world of decentralized finance. With its ability to provide high liquidity, low fees, and enhanced security, 0x is poised to remain a cornerstone of the DeFi revolution.
Comments
Post a Comment